Europe’s forests have lost 46% more aboveground biomass per hectare each year since 2018 than in the previous three decades, according to a satellite-based study published in Nature Geoscience. Researchers from the Technical University of Munich analysed forest changes from 1985 to 2023, finding a sharp rise in damage after 2018.

Drought weakened trees across Central Europe, allowing bark beetles to spread, while storms and wildfires added to losses. Germany, the Czech Republic and Poland were badly affected. Forest management, including timber harvesting, caused 82% of biomass loss over the full study period, but natural disturbances rose from 17% before 2018 to 23% thereafter. Germany’s disturbed forests release about 230 tonnes of carbon dioxide per hectare annually.
The easy story is that climate change alone is destroying Europe’s forests. The opposite claim, that logging explains everything, is also incomplete. The study assigns most long-term biomass loss to forest management, while drought and beetles are driving the recent increase. That distinction matters for climate targets and forestry policy. Future satellite measurements should show whether natural disturbances keep rising above the 23% recorded from 2018 to 2023.
